Low voter turnout is expected in a special election on Tuesday, Aug. 11, to determine the Republican candidate to face Democrat incumbent U.S. Rep. Terri Sewell in the Nov. 3 general election. Neither Ammie Akin nor David Perry have held elected office. Akin describes herself as an entrepreneur, an educator and an advocate for individuals with disabilities. Perry is a retired pastor and ran unsuccessfully for the Republican nomination for a state school board seat. Sewell is seeking her ninth term.
